The Unique Flavors of Sautéed Fennel

What is Sautéed Fennel?

Sautéed fennel is a dish prepared by cooking fennel bulbs in a small amount of oil or butter. The process involves gently heating the fennel until it becomes tender and caramelized, allowing its natural flavors to shine through. The result is a dish that is both sweet and slightly bitter, with a hint of anise.

The Aromatics of Fennel

Fennel is a member of the parsley family and is native to the Mediterranean region. It has a distinct aroma and taste that is often described as licorice-like. This aromatic quality makes sautéed fennel a versatile ingredient that can be used in a variety of dishes, from salads to pasta sauces.

Health Benefits of Sautéed Fennel

Nutritional Value

Sautéed fennel is not only delicious but also packed with nutrients. It is a good source of vitamins A, C, and K, as well as dietary fiber, potassium, and folate. These nutrients contribute to overall health and well-being, making sautéed fennel a nutritious addition to any meal.

Anti-inflammatory Properties

Fennel contains compounds that have anti-inflammatory properties, which can help reduce inflammation in the body. This makes sautéed fennel a great choice for those looking to incorporate anti-inflammatory foods into their diet.

Sautéed Fennel Recipes

Sautéed Fennel with Lemon and Garlic

This recipe combines the sweet and bitter flavors of sautéed fennel with the tangy taste of lemon and the pungent aroma of garlic. The result is a dish that is both comforting and refreshing.

Ingredients:

– 1 bulb of fennel, trimmed and sliced

– 2 cloves of garlic, minced

– 1 lemon, zest and juice

– 2 tablespoons of olive oil

–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ions:

1.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at.

2. Add the sliced fennel and cook for about 5 minutes, or until it starts to soften.

3. Add the minced garlic and cook for another 2 minutes.

4. Stir in the lemon zest and juice, and season with salt and pepper.

5. Cook for another 2 minutes, or until the fennel is tender and caramelized.

Sautéed Fennel and Asparagus Pasta

This recipe combines the delicate flavors of sautéed fennel with the crispness of asparagus and the richness of pasta. It is a simple yet elegant dish that is perfect for a weeknight meal.

Ingredients:

– 1 bulb of fennel, trimmed and sliced

– 1 bunch of asparagus, trimmed and sliced

– 1 pound of pasta (such as spaghetti or penne)

– 2 tablespoons of olive oil

– 1 garlic clove, minced

– Salt and pepper to taste

– Parmesan cheese, grated

Instructions:

1. Cook the pasta according to package instructions, reserving 1 cup of pasta water.

2. While the pasta is cooking, he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at.

3. Add the sliced fennel and asparagus, and cook for about 5 minutes, or until the vegetables are tender.

4. Add the minced garlic and cook for another minute.

5. Add the cooked pasta to the skillet, tossing to combine.

6. Season with salt and pepper, and add the reserved pasta water if needed.

7. Serve with grated Parmesan cheese on top.
